R.A.T. Tone Programming Unit for PROGRAMMABLE SOUNDER:


1) Connect the E2S programmer unit to the sounder to be programmed, on AC units the black wire is connected to terminal ‘-/C’, on DC units the black wire is connected to a negative ‘-’ terminal on the sounder PCB. On AC & DC units the Orange wire is connected to terminal S2 and the Yellow wire is connected to terminal S3.

 

2) Connect the sounder to be programmed to the appropriate supply voltage i.e. 24V DC, 115V or 230V AC depending on the voltage of the unit that is being programmed.


    SAFETY NOTE: Extreme care must be taken when programming AC units.

 

3) Switch on the power supply to the unit and after a period of 3-4 seconds of silence a low level single beep will be heard. This indicates that the unit is ready to be programmed for the stage 1 tone.

 

4) Consult the tone table to find the “Tone Code” for the required stage 1 tone. This will be a six digit binary number i.e. 110010 for tone number 20, “Continuous at 660Hz.”

 

5) Enter the six digit tone code by pressing the ‘0’ and ‘1’ buttons accordingly. Short high or low beeps will be heard each time a button is pressed, high for ‘1’ and low for ‘0’.When the stage 1 code has been entered a double beep will be heard to indicate that the unit is ready to be programmed for stage 2.

 

6) Enter the tone code for the required stage 2 tone. On completion a triple beep will be heard to indicate that the unit is ready to be programmed for stage 3.

 

7) Enter the tone code for the required stage 3 tone. On completion four beeps will be heard to indicate that the unit is ready to be programmed for stage 4.

 

8) Enter the tone code for the required stage 4 tone. On completion the unit will be returned to stage 1 in case a mistake has been made in which case the above procedure is repeated.

 

9) The programming mode can then be exited by switching off the supply and removing the programming connections.

 

 

NOTES:

 


a) If the programming mode is exited before all four stages are programmed, only the tones entered will be changed, the others will remain on their previous tones.

 

b) When stage 3 is programmed, the tone is also copied to stage 4, so stages 3 and 4 will be the same unless stage 4 is programmed to be a different tone.

 

c) If an invalid tone code is entered, the unit will sound a double high-low beep, and then sound the number of beeps for the stage being programmed, so the correct tone code can be re-entered.

 

 

 
 

Stage 1:Frequency Description:Binary Code:
 
Tone 1340 Hz Continuous0 0 0 0 0 0
Tone 2 800/1000Hz @ 0.25 sec Alternating 1 0 0 0 0 0
Tone 3 500/1200Hz @ 0.3Hz 0.5 sec Slow Whoop 0 1 0 0 0 0
Tone 4 800/1000Hz @ 1Hz Sweeping1 1 0 0 0 0
Tone 5 2400Hz Continuous0 0 1 0 0 0
Tone 62400/2900Hz @ 7Hz Sweeping 1 0 1 0 0 0
Tone 72400/2900Hz @ 1Hz Sweeping 0 1 1 0 0 0
Tone 8500/1200/500Hz @ 0.3Hz Sweeping1 1 1 0 0 0
Tone 91200/500Hz @ 1Hz - DIN / PFEER P.T.A.P.0 0 0 1 0 0
Tone 102400/2900Hz @ 2Hz Alternating 1 0 0 1 0 0
Tone 111000Hz @ 1Hz Intermittent 0 1 0 1 0 0
Tone 12800/1000Hz @ 0.875Hz Alternating 1 1 0 1 0 0
Tone 132400Hz @ 1Hz Intermittent0 0 1 1 0 0
Tone 14800Hz 0.25sec on, 1 sec off Intermittent 1 0 1 1 0 0
Tone 15800Hz Continuous 0 1 1 1 0 0
Tone 16660Hz 150mS on, 150mS off Intermittent 1 1 1 1 0 0
Tone 17544Hz (100mS)/440Hz (400mS) - NF S 32-0010 0 0 0 1 0
Tone 18 660Hz 1.8sec on, 1.8sec off Intermittent1 0 0 0 1 0
Tone 19 1.4KHz-1.6KHz 1s, 1.6KHz-1.4KHz 0.5s-0 1 0 0 1 0
NFC48-265
Tone 20 660Hz Continuous1 1 0 0 1 0
Tone 21 554Hz/440Hz @ 1Hz Alternating0 0 1 0 1 0
Tone 22 544Hz @ 0.875 sec. Intermittent 1 0 1 0 1 0
Tone 23 800Hz @ 2Hz Intermittent0 1 1 0 1 0
Tone 24800/1000Hz @ 50Hz Sweeping1 1 1 0 1 0
Tone 252400/2900Hz @ 50Hz Sweeping0 0 0 1 1 0
Tone 26 Bell 1 0 0 1 1 0
Tone 27 554Hz Continuous 0 1 0 1 1 0
Tone 28440Hz Continuous 1 1 0 1 1 0
Tone 29800/1000Hz @ 7Hz Sweeping0 0 1 1 1 0
Tone 30300Hz Continuous1 0 1 1 1 0
Tone 31 660/1200Hz @ 1Hz Sweeping 0 1 1 1 1 0
Tone 32Two tone chime1 1 1 1 1 0
Tone 33 745Hz @ 1Hz Intermittent 0 0 0 0 0 1
Tone 34 1000 & 2000Hz @ 0.5 sec Alternating - 1 0 0 0 0 1
Singapore
Tone 35 420Hz @ 0.625 sec Australian Alert0 1 0 0 0 1
Tone 36 500-1200Hz 3.75sec /0.25sec. Australian Evac.1 1 0 0 0 1
Tone 37 1000Hz Continuous - PFEER Toxic Gas0 0 1 0 0 1
Tone 38 2000Hz Continuous1 0 1 0 0 1
Tone 39 Silence0 1 1 0 0 1
Tone 40 Custom continuous tone - Contact E2S 1 1 1 0 0 1
Tone 41 Motor Siren - slow rise to 1200 Hz0 0 0 1 0 1
Tone 42 Motor Siren - slow rise to 800 Hz 1 0 0 1 0 1
Tone 43 1200 Hz Continuous 0 1 0 1 0 1
Tone 44 Motor Siren - slow rise to 2400 Hz 1 1 0 1 0 1
Tone 45 1KHz 1s on, 1s off Intermittent - 0 0 1 1 0 1
PFEER Gen. Alarm
